题解 | #单链表的排序#

单链表的排序

http://www.nowcoder.com/practice/f23604257af94d939848729b1a5cda08


/*
 * public class ListNode {
 *   int val;
 *   ListNode next = null;
 * }
 */

public class Solution {
    /**
     * 
     * @param head ListNode类 the head node
     * @return ListNode类
     */
    public ListNode sortInList (ListNode head) {
        // write code here
        if (head == null || head.next == null) {
            return head;
        }
        List<Integer> list = new ArrayList<>();
        while (head != null) {
            list.add(head.val);
            head = head.next;
        }
        int[] arr = new int[list.size()];
        for (int i = 0; i < arr.length; i++) {
            arr[i] = list.get(i);
        }
        quickSort(arr, 0, arr.length - 1);
        
        head = new ListNode(arr[0]);
        ListNode tail = head;
        for (int i = 1; i < arr.length; i++) {
            ListNode cur = new ListNode(arr[i]);
            tail.next = cur;
            tail = cur;
        }
        return head;
    }
    
    private void quickSort(int[] arr, int left, int right) {
        if (left < right) {
            int mid = partition(arr, left, right);
            quickSort(arr, left, mid - 1);
            quickSort(arr, mid + 1, right);
        }
    }
    
    private int partition(int[] arr, int left, int right) {
        int temp = arr[left];
        while (left < right) {
            while (left < right && arr[right] >= temp) {
                right--;
            }
            arr[left] = arr[right];
            while (left < right && arr[left] <= temp) {
                left++;
            }
            arr[right] = arr[left];
        }
        arr[left] = temp;
        return left;
    }
    
    
    
    
    
    
}
